IMsRdpClient10 介面

提供設定和使用用戶端控制項所需的方法和屬性。 衍生自 IMsRdpClient9 介面。

成員

IMsRdpClient10介面繼承自IMsRdpClient9IMsRdpClient10 也有下列類型的成員:

方法

IMsRdpClient10介面具有這些方法。

方法 Description
attachEvent 附加事件。
detachEvent 中斷連結事件。
GetErrorDescription 擷取會話中斷線上活動的錯誤描述。
GetStatusText 擷取指定狀態碼的狀態文字。
GetVirtualChannelOptions 擷取虛擬通道設定的選項。
重新連接 重新連線到具有新桌面寬度和高度的遠端會話。
RequestClose 要求遠端桌面 ActiveX 控制項的正常關機。
SendRemoteAction 導致遠端會話中執行動作。
SetVirtualChannelOptions 設定遠端桌面 ActiveX 控制項的虛擬通道選項。
SyncSessionDisplaySettings 同步處理會話顯示設定。
UpdateSessionDisplaySettings 更新會話顯示設定。

屬性

IMsRdpClient10介面具有這些屬性。

屬性 存取類型 Description
AdvancedSettings2
唯讀
擷取 IMsRdpClientAdvancedSettings 介面的指標。 介面可用來設定用戶端控制項的進階設定。
AdvancedSettings3
唯讀
擷取 IMsRdpClientAdvancedSettings2 介面的指標。 介面可用來設定用戶端控制項的進階設定。
AdvancedSettings4
唯讀
擷取 IMsRdpClientAdvancedSettings3 介面的 指標。
AdvancedSettings5
唯讀
擷取 IMsRdpClientAdvancedSettings4 介面的 指標。
AdvancedSettings6
唯讀
擷取 IMsRdpClientAdvancedSettings5 介面。
AdvancedSettings7
唯讀
擷取 IMsRdpClientAdvancedSettings6 介面。
AdvancedSettings8
唯讀
擷取支援 IMsRdpClientAdvancedSettings7 介面的物件。
AdvancedSettings9
唯讀
包含支援 IMsRdpClientAdvancedSettings8 介面的物件。
ColorDepth
讀取/寫入
每個圖元的色彩深度 () 控制項連線的位。
ConnectedStatusText
讀取/寫入
包含控制項處於線上狀態時,顯示在控制項工作區中的文字。
ExtendedDisconnectReason
唯讀
包含控制項中斷連線原因的擴充資訊。
FullScreen
讀取/寫入
判斷用戶端控制項是否處於全螢幕模式。
MsRdpClientShell
唯讀
擷取可編寫腳本的用戶端設定介面 IMsRdpClientShell
RemoteProgram
唯讀
擷取支援 ITSRemoteProgram 介面的物件。
RemoteProgram2
唯讀
擷取支援 ITSRemoteProgram2 介面的物件。
RemoteProgram3
唯讀
支援 ITSRemoteProgram3 介面的物件。
SecuredSettings2
唯讀
擷取 IMsRdpClientSecuredSettings 介面的指標。 這個介面可用來設定用戶端控制項的安全設定。
SecuredSettings3
唯讀
擷取支援 IMsRdpClientSecuredSettings2 介面的物件。
TransportSettings
唯讀
擷取透過腳本傳遞至 IMsRdpClientTransportSettings 介面的內容。
TransportSettings2
唯讀
擷取 IMsRdpClientTransportSettings2 介面。
TransportSettings3
唯讀
擷取支援 IMsRdpClientTransportSettings3 介面的物件
TransportSettings4
唯讀
擷取支援 IMsRdpClientTransportSettings4 介面的物件

備註

如需遠端桌面 Web 連線的詳細資訊,請參閱 遠端桌面 Web 連線的需求

規格需求

需求
最低支援的用戶端
Windows 10 [僅限傳統型應用程式]
最低支援的伺服器
Windows Server 2016
類型程式庫
MsTscAx.dll
DLL
MsTscAx.dll
CLSID
CLSID_MsRdpClient10定義為 C0EFA91A-EEB7-41C7-97FA-F0ED645EFB24
CLSID_MsRdpClient10NotSafeForScripting定義為 A0C63C30-F08D-4AB4-907C-34905D770C7D
IID
IID_IMsRdpClient10定義為 7ED92C39-EB38-4927-A70A-708AC5A59321

另請參閱

IMsRdpClient9

IMsRdpClient8

IMsRdpClient7

IMsRdpClient6

IMsRdpClient5

IMsRdpClient4

IMsRdpClient3

IMsRdpClient2

IMsRdpClient

IMsTscAx

遠端桌面 Web 連線參考